We’re recruiting on behalf of our client, a leading financial services group, for a facilities assistant, to join on a 6 month contract.
The Role…
The successful applicant will support the Isle of Man office refurbishment to contribute to the provision of a fully functional and operational office environment. Duties will include:
Assisting the line manager with maintaining compliance with health and safety legislation, serve as the health and safety representative to ensure the health and safety of the users, including the execution of display screen equipment workstation assessments, monitor and replenish first aid boxes etc.
Control the keys and door cards to the facilities in accordance with the policy and approved process
Maintain and repair facilities to ensure their availability and the safety and health of users. Including calling out third party maintenance, specialist, engineers, sub contractors, keeping records of maintenance and repairs made
Deliver on the internal and external postal requirements of the organisation, including monitoring of the franking machine and dealing with courier packages, registered and recorded mail, collect, distribute and recycle daily newspapers
Execute archive storage and retrieval with proper record keeping
About You…
You will have previous experience within a similar role, and::
5 GCSEs grade C or above
Institution of occupational safety and health certification (IOSH) or an equivalent health and safety certificate
Excellent time management skills
Ability to effectively communicate internally and externally
